Пакет Yesod-form: Проблем с стартирането на програми чрез wai-handler-devel

Всичко,

Направих копие на hello-forms.hs от пакета yesod-form, само за да направя някои експерименти. Когато го стартирам чрез основната функция, сървърът се справя добре, напр. на порт 2500. HalloWelt.hs е тук.

Но когато се опитам да стартирам тази програма в bash конзола чрез wai-handler-devel - като съм в директорията, където се намира HalloWelt.hs ( http://hpaste.org/48381 ) се намира...

wai-handler-devel 2600 HalloWelt с HalloWelt

Взимам...

Опит за тълкуване на вашето приложение... Компилирането е неуспешно: NotAllowed "модулът не е зареден: `HalloWelt' (./HalloWelt.hs)"

Каква може да е причината за това?

Благодаря ви за всякакви съвети -

С най-добри пожелания Хартмут


person Hartmut P.    schedule 28.06.2011    source източник


Отговори (1)


Мисля, че имате нужда от "module HalloWelt where" в горната част на вашия файл.

О, и не пренебрегвах въпроса за уеб разработката, просто все още не бях имал възможност да го разгледам.

person Michael Snoyman    schedule 28.06.2011
comment
Добре, добавям модула HalloWelt, където след езиковите разширения работи перфектно. Благодаря ви за бързата помощ. - person Hartmut P.; 29.06.2011